EIA Data Query
Query U.S. Energy Information Administration datasets.
Compute standard IEEE reliability metrics from outage records. Input your outage data and get SAIDI, SAIFI, CAIDI, and related indices instantly.
Add to your claude_desktop_config.json under "mcpServers":
"saidi-calculator": {
"command": "npx",
"args": ["@saral/mcp-reliability"]
}Compute standard IEEE reliability metrics from outage records. Input your outage data and get SAIDI, SAIFI, CAIDI, and related indices instantly.
Update frequency: On-demand calculation
North American Electric Reliability Corporation
Federal Energy Regulatory Commission
California Public Utilities Commission
Public Utility Commission of Texas
New York Public Service Commission
Massachusetts Department of Public Utilities
Power Grid Corporation of India Limited
Central Electricity Regulatory Commission (India)
Australian Energy Market Operator
National Grid Electricity System Operator (UK)
| Name | Type | Required | Description |
|---|---|---|---|
| outages | array | Yes | Array of {customers_affected, duration_minutes, [cause]} |
| total_customers | number | Yes | Total customers served |
| exclude_med | boolean | No | Exclude major event days (IEEE 1366) |
| Name | Type | Description |
|---|---|---|
| saidi | number | System Average Interruption Duration Index (minutes) |
| saifi | number | System Average Interruption Frequency Index |
| caidi | number | Customer Average Interruption Duration Index (minutes) |
| asai | number | Average Service Availability Index |
Standard IEEE 1366 definitions for SAIDI, SAIFI, CAIDI, ASAI.
Yes, set exclude_med=true to apply IEEE 1366 2.5 beta method.
Coming soon - we'll include EIA 861 peer comparisons.